Output 30594822e1790f554119b23616cabaec38e2e81fab6d91c38742bc1aff513e7a:1
- value
- 609245
- script pubkey
- OP_0 OP_PUSHBYTES_20 880436f2cb1b5b20b7eba73ab563b438c4bdf285
- address
- bc1q3qzrduktrddjpdlt5uat2ca58rztmu59hpzcm6
- transaction
- 30594822e1790f554119b23616cabaec38e2e81fab6d91c38742bc1aff513e7a